About 5-cyclopropyl-N-[1-(1-phenylethyl)piperidin-4-yl]-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ide
5-cyclopropyl-N-[1-(1-phenylethyl)piperidin-4-yl]-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ide (PubChem CID 119041845) has the molecular formula C20H25N3O2
and a molecular weight of 339.44 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 5-cyclopropyl-N-[1-(1-phenylethyl)piperidin-4-yl]-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ide.

What is the SMILES notation for 5-cyclopropyl-N-[1-(1-phenylethyl)piperidin-4-yl]-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ide?
The canonical SMILES for 5-cyclopropyl-N-[1-(1-phenylethyl)piperidin-4-yl]-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ide is CC(c1ccccc1)N1CCC(NC(=O)c2cc(C3CC3)on2)CC1.
What is the InChIKey of 5-cyclopropyl-N-[1-(1-phenylethyl)piperidin-4-yl]-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ide?
The InChIKey is GBLJLXSGVZCWFG-UHFFFAOYS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C20H25N3O2/c1-14(15-5-3-2-4-6-15)23-11-9-17(10-12-23)21-20(24)18-13-19(25-22-18)16-7-8-16/h2-6,13-14,16-17H,7-12H2,1H3,(H,21,24).
What are the key properties of 5-cyclopropyl-N-[1-(1-phenylethyl)piperidin-4-yl]-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ide?
5-cyclopropyl-N-[1-(1-phenylethyl)piperidin-4-yl]-1,2-oxazole-3-carboxamide has a molecular weight of 339.44 g/mol, XLogP of 3.51, 5 rotatable bonds, 1 hydrogen bond donors, and 4 hydrogen bond acceptors.
